3.3 Inverter Placement Considerations
Although the GTIB-30 inverter is designed to be as efficient as possible, some heat is
inevitably generated by the unit. The GTIB-30 needs to be installed in such a manner
that hot air generated by the unit can escape.
The entire enclosure is used to dissipate waste heat. At high power, the temperature
of the entire enclosure will therefore increase significantly. Hot spots on the
enclosure may reach up to 140 degrees Fahrenheit (60 ºC). Ensure that no
temperature sensitive objects are close to or touching any part of the inverter
enclosure at any time. Also ensure that small children are unable to access the area
where the inverter is stored.
Hot air is designed to escape from the inverter through the ventilation louvers on the
right side of the inverter which is shown in Figure 20.
Figure 20: GTIB-30 View showing ventilation louvers.
For optimal performance, please ensure that these ventilation louvers are not blocked
by surrounding objects or walls.
Under no circumstances, should the right side of the inverter be moved directly up
against a wall or other object. This will prevent air flow through the ventilation
louvers and will also prevent the enclosure door from opening.
For optimal performance, it is recommended to leave as much open space around the
inverter as possible for optimal natural cooling. The minimum space requirement on
the right and the front of the GTIB-30 inverter for full power capability is 12 inches.
The following is a list of the above requirements and other considerations that should
be taken into account in order to get the most out of the GTIB-30 inverter:
1.
Mount the enclosure away from heat sensitive equipment and/or objects,
since the enclosure heats up considerably during operation
2.
Ensure that the ventilation louvers on the right and the front of the
enclosure are not obstructed.
